Designed for mobile catering
The insulated bag makes it easy to take your 5 litre EcoreKeg to beer tastings, garden parties, camping, festivals, trade fairs and other events.
The practical pocket keeps the original hand pump assembled with the keg during transport, so all necessary equipment is close at hand. When it's time for serving, the bag opens only at the top, allowing the hand pump to be fitted while the rest of the bag continues to protect and insulate the keg.
The result is an elegant, practical, and professional serving solution.

FAQ
What is the insulated bag used for?
The bag protects the 5-litre EcoreKeg during transport and helps to keep the beverages cool during serving.
Can the hand pump be stored in the bag?
Yes. The bag has an external pocket specifically designed for the original hand pump for the 5-litre EcoreKeg.
Should the bag be removed during serving?
No. The bag can be unzipped at the top, allowing the hand pump to be attached while the rest of the bag continues to encase the keg.
Does the propellant come into contact with the drink?
No. The Bag-in-Keg system keeps the propellant gas separate from the beverage. CO₂, compressed air, nitrogen, or other suitable propellant gases can be used without coming into contact with the contents.
Does the bag fit all 5-litre EcoreKegs?
Yes. It is specifically developed for the 5-litre EcoreKeg.
